Repairing Double Glazed Windows

If your double glazing has misted up or has difficulty opening, it may require repair. This is typically a sign that the seals have failed, and it is essential to get this fixed quickly to prevent further damage.

locksmith-workman-in-uniform-installing-door-knob-2023-01-05-00-20-11-utc.jpgTechnicians will drill tiny holes into the window to expel water. It may take a few days for the windows to completely dry and stop fogging.

Seals

Double glazing can improve your home's energy efficiency by allowing warm air into the winter months and making it less noisy from outside. This is accomplished by creating a gas-filled air gap between the two glass panes. The gap is sealed and creates an insulation barrier which reduces the transfer of heat from one side of the window to the opposite side.

Double glazed windows can reduce external condensation and dampness. In the past it was normal for condensation to build up on windows due to a lack of an airtight seal but the use of inert gas and seals on a double glazed window stops this from happening.

However, over time, the effectiveness of the double glazed unit may decrease and the signs of this include misty windows. If your double-glazed windows are blurred, it's a sign that the seals on your windows have been damaged. This allows moisture to enter and cause condensation.

The quality of the installation and the manufacturer is a major factor in how quickly these issues develop, which is why choosing a reputable installer and supplier is essential. Faults most commonly occur when windows are not installed correctly or the insulating films are installed improperly.

If the defects are visible and the window is damaged, it will need to be replaced. It's costly but you'll save money when you don't heat your home.

Glass

Double glazing is made up of two panes of glass with a gap which is filled with a gas, such as Krypton or argon. The unit is referred to as an IGU, or an insulated unit (IGU) and is set within the frame of upvc Windows Repairs near me or aluminium.

Double-glazed windows are made to give better insulation to cold and heat, helping to reduce the cost of energy. However, the efficiency of your window glass can be diminished if the seals are damaged or break.

Condensation between the panes of glass is a indication that double glazing is not functioning properly. This can happen if the seals are broken however, it can also happen when there are slight variations in the temperature between the rooms where the windows are.

It is possible to fix misted windows and doors however the cost will be more expensive than replacing them with new ones. To do this, a professional will need drill holes in the glass to let out any moisture. This process can take a couple of hours or several days. Once the water is expelled, the holes will be sealed and a protective layer applied.

In certain cases this may be enough to return the window back to its original function. If the seals are totally broken or the frame has been badly damaged, it may not be able to work.

Frames

Double-glazed windows provide insulation against cold and heat. This can reduce energy bills. They can be damaged, which can reduce their efficiency. Double glazing repair specialists are able to fix this and bring back the advantages of your home's double-glazed windows.

While it is possible to replace windows with double glazing however, repairs are generally less expensive and faster. The most frequent issue that double-glazed windows face is misting. This happens when moisture seeps through the two glass panes and causes condensation. This could be due to various reasons, including a failure of the seal between the panes, or damage to the glass. It is crucial to fix the issue as quickly as you can. A professional can assist you with this.

Over time frames of your double-glazed windows can also develop problems. This is more likely to happen in older windows, and it may result in problems with handles or hinges. Double-glazing specialists can determine the problem, and replace the required part. This will usually restore the functionality of your upvc window repairs window, without needing to replace them.
